커스텀 오버레이 질문

image

위에 사진처럼 커스텀 오버레이에 있는 X 를 통해 오버레이를 끄게 만들고 싶지만 그게 안되네요…

아래는 코드입니다…
image
image

코드에서 닫기 버튼만 클릭 이벤트가 등록되어 있습니다.
data.content를 document.createElement로 만든 HTMLElement로 구성해서 X버튼에 클릭 이벤트를 등록해주세요.

1개의 좋아요

image

샘플에 있던 코드를 내용만 수정해서 사용했었는데…
하나의 마커만 사용할 때는 이런 식으로만 해도 X 버튼이 사용이 됬었습니다…
처음인지라… 어떻게 이벤트를 등록해야 할까요…?
혹시 참고할 만한 그게 있을까요…?

이전 게시글에 링크를 드렸었는데 다시 첨부해 드립니다.
문제를 해결하기 위해서 content에 들어갈 요소를 문자열이 아닌 HTMLElement로 구성해서 적용해주세요.
즉, 현재 data.content가 문자열로 구성되어 있는데 이를 HTMLElement로 변경해주시고
X버튼 요소에 closeBtn의 onclick이벤트와 동일하게 이벤트를 적용해주세요.

https://devtalk.kakao.com/t/topic/103147/2
https://devtalk.kakao.com/t/topic/126813/2

1개의 좋아요

많이 햇갈려서… 눈 앞에 있는걸 보지 못했네요… 죄송합니다. 해결에 도움 주셔서 감사합니다…!

1개의 좋아요